c语言-leetcode题解之0073-set-matrix-zeroes.zip


在计算机科学领域,特别是编程和算法设计方面,LeetCode是一个著名的在线平台,它为程序员提供了大量的编程题目来练习,尤其是那些准备参加技术面试的人。这些题目覆盖了各种难度级别,从初级到高级,包括数据结构和算法的各个方面。LeetCode的题目通常很接近实际工作中的问题,因此它成为了程序员提高编程能力、准备面试的热门工具。 C语言是一种广泛使用的编程语言,它以其高效、灵活和接近硬件层面的能力而闻名。在LeetCode中,很多题目都提供了C语言的解决方案,帮助程序员在解决问题的同时加强对C语言的掌握。 题解是指对某一问题的解答或解决方案。在编程和算法领域,题解不仅展示了如何正确解决一个编程难题,而且还通常包括了代码示例、算法分析、优化建议和可能的面试考点。一个详尽的题解可以帮助读者更好地理解问题的本质,学习到解决类似问题的思路和方法。 “c语言-leetcode题解之0073-set-matrix-zeroes.zip”这个压缩包文件的标题表明,它包含的是关于LeetCode第73题“Set Matrix Zeroes”的C语言题解。第73题是一个经典的算法问题,要求实现一个函数,该函数接受一个二维整数数组(矩阵)作为输入,并将矩阵中的所有元素设置为零,如果该元素所在的行或列包含至少一个零。这道题目考察了算法设计、空间优化以及对数据结构的深刻理解。 在编写题解时,可能的思路包括使用额外的空间来记录哪些行或列需要被设置为零,或者尝试不使用额外空间的方法,比如通过首行和首列来记录零的位置,因为它们同时是其他行和列的成员。这类优化方法能够显著减少算法的时间和空间复杂度。 对于算法初学者而言,理解和实现这样的题解是一个挑战,但对于想要在技术面试中脱颖而出的程序员来说,掌握这类题目的解决方案是必要的。题解不仅是解题的关键,更是学习高效算法思维和代码实现的宝贵资源。 总结以上内容,可以认为“c语言-leetcode题解之0073-set_matrix_zeroes.zip”这个压缩包文件是针对LeetCode平台上的经典算法问题——“Set Matrix Zeroes”的C语言解法的集合。它不仅提供了解题代码,还可能包含了算法分析和优化技巧,为学习者提供了深入学习和实践的材料。




























- 1


- 粉丝: 3004
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 计算机网络实验(华东交大完整版h3c).doc
- VB程序自动评分系统研究与设计.docx
- 基于改进粒子群优化算法优化 BP 神经网络的房价预测研究 改进粒子群优化算法应用于 BP 神经网络的房价预测优化 采用改进粒子群优化算法优化 BP 神经网络实现房价预测 改进粒子群优化算法优化 BP
- PLC饮料罐装生产流水线1.doc
- 科技互联网公司简介模板ppt模板.pptx
- 基于光电传感器的转速测量系统设计---单片机---光电转速传感器---转速测量---数据处理.doc
- 计算机网络的安全问题及应对方案.docx
- (源码)基于物联网的智能家居温控与监控项目.zip
- 人工智能来了-综艺呢?.docx
- 计算机网络信息安全技术的状况探微.docx
- 【精选】多彩大气互联网科技风行业通用PPT背景ppt模板.pptx
- 软件设计方案与体系结构作业.doc
- 年深圳宝安区笔试计算机教师考题.doc
- 数据采集战略市场规划报告.docx
- 光纤通信技术在电力通信中的应用效果和价值分析.docx
- jsp网上书店系统(大学本科方案设计书).doc


